If you only have one credit card at a time, you only have to pay the €30 charge once per year. It's paid every April, or when the account is closed.
Ryanair Visa are correct in charging you the €30 government stamp duty when you close your account with them.
You should ask for an exemption letter from Ryanair Visa, and send it to UB when you get it.
When UB get the exemption letter, you won't have to pay the €30 duty again in April.
